Waste water container

I am trying to locate a particular wastewater container called 'Waste Water Kanister' that I saw in a catalogue in 2004. I contacted the company selling these but they no longer stock this item. Our van has a very low drainpipe and at seven inches tall this item would be ideal for us. Do you know where I can obtain a similar item?
Allan Smith, by email

MIKE SAYS
After an exhaustive search I'm afraid I can't find any reference to a 'Waste Water Kanister'. I assume it's a German make as kanister is German for canister.

Throughout my years as an avid motor caavanner I've collected a rather good collection of waste containers and after an enjoyable hour spent polishing (and measuring) my collection I can't find any which are slim enough for your needs – seven inches is very little room.

My suggestion is to attach a length of convoluted hose to the outlet and run this to a fairly low line waste tank like the Aquaroll Wastemaster, which comes in 38 or 30 litres.

See www.aquaroll.com for more details. Of course you'll have a small 'U' bend so you won't drain your system completely of water but the small amount the 'U' bend will trap shouldn't be a major problem.
